Question:

If $X = \{4^n- 3 n - 1: n \in N \}$ and $Y = \{9 (n - 1): n \in N \}$ ,where $N$ is the set of natural numbers, then $ X \cup Y$ is equal to

The Correct Option is D

Solution and Explanation

$X=\left\{(1+3)^{n}-3 n-1, n \in N\right\}$
$=3^{2}({ }^{n} C_{2}+{ }^{n} C_{3} \cdot 3+\ldots+3^{n-2}), n \in N\} $
$=\{\text { Divisible by } 9\}$
$Y=\{9(n-1), n \in N\} $
$=(\text { All multiples of } 9\} $
So, $X \subseteq Y $
i.e., $X \cup Y=Y $

Sets

Set is the collection of well defined objects. Sets are represented by capital letters, eg. A={}. Sets are composed of elements which could be numbers, letters, shapes, etc.

Example of set: Set of vowels A={a,e,i,o,u}

Representation of Sets

There are three basic notation or representation of sets are as follows:

Statement Form: The statement representation describes a statement to show what are the elements of a set.

  • For example, Set A is the list of the first five odd numbers.

Roster Form: The form in which elements are listed in set. Elements in the set is seperatrd by comma and enclosed within the curly braces.

  • For example represent the set of vowels in roster form.

A={a,e,i,o,u}

Set Builder Form: 

  1. The set builder representation has a certain rule or a statement that specifically describes the common feature of all the elements of a set.
  2. The set builder form uses a vertical bar in its representation, with a text describing the character of the elements of the set.
  3. For example, A = { k | k is an even number, k ≤ 20}. The statement says, all the elements of set A are even numbers that are less than or equal to 20.
  4. Sometimes a ":" is used in the place of the "|".
